China – The automotive production and sales joint venture of Honda in China will now benefit from a third vehicle plant and an engine manufacturing facility at its existing Zengcheng site. The vehicle plant has a capacity of 120,000 units and began production in September.

The third car factory of Guangqi Honda Automobiles (GHAC) is described by the OEM as “an eco-plant” with “various smart features” which not only boasts advanced production technologies but minimises its environmental footprint. Honda claims it features the largest solar power generation system operated by a vehicle-maker in China.

The new plant brings Honda’s total vehicle production capacity in China to more than 1m units per year, combining all GHAC and Dongfeng Honda locations.
